
spring
文章平均质量分 81
f776527249
这个作者很懒,什么都没留下…
展开
-
spring 2.5 mvc 注解 ajax 实现
spring 2.5 的mvc 大量的使用了注解,减少了xml文件的配置,使spring 使用起来更为简单,在下面我以一个spring 2.5 mvc 注解的一个 ajax 的实现。 雷武銮 首先来看一下action类的配置:import com.web.comm.actions.BasicAction;import com.web.module.user_manag...2010-03-07 19:30:22 · 143 阅读 · 0 评论 -
spring 事务管理
对于J2EE 应用程序而言,事务的处理一般有两种模式: 1. 依赖特定事务资源的事务处理这是应用开发中最常见的模式,即通过特定资源提供的事务机制进行事务管理。如通过JDBC、JTA 的rollback、commit方法;Hibernate Transaction 的rollback、commit方法等。这种方法大家已经相当熟悉。 2. 依赖容器的参数化事务管理通过容器提供的...原创 2009-08-04 23:31:51 · 112 阅读 · 0 评论 -
SSH(Spring+Struts+Hibernate)综合应用
(1)Struts与Spring整合<1> 在struts配置文件中配置spring配置文件 <plug-in className="org.springframework.web.struts.ContextLoaderPlugIn"> <set-property property="contextConfigLocation" value...原创 2009-08-04 23:56:17 · 89 阅读 · 0 评论 -
spring配置事务
<?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:aop="http:/原创 2010-01-27 17:38:47 · 105 阅读 · 0 评论 -
Spring Jar包详解
摘自:http://vc88.iteye.com/blog/360703spring.jar是包含有完整发布的单个jar包,spring.jar中包含除了 spring-mock.jar里所包含的内容外其它所有jar包的内容,因为只有在开发环境下才会用到spring-mock.jar来进行辅助测试,正式应用系统中是用不得这些类的。 除了spring.jar文件,Spring还包括有其它独立的j...原创 2010-01-28 13:35:41 · 110 阅读 · 0 评论 -
spring 2.0_MVC+Ibatis web 实例
这个便子是我在面试之后回来做的, 前段时间不久,我去面试,那个公司说要用spring 2.0 加上ibatis 框架用得越少越好,而且版本低点,会比较成熟,因为人家做国税的吗。下面就是本人花了1个小时的时间简单的配了一下: username="雷武銮"其中包括spring 的事务的配置:<bean id="transactionManager" ...2010-03-04 01:50:25 · 131 阅读 · 0 评论 -
spring 2.5 注释驱动的IOC功能
spring 注释功相当于以前在spring的配置文件的bean头中加入了:default-autowire="byName"default-autowire="byType" Spring 通过一个 BeanPostProcessor 对 @Autowired 进行解析,所以要让 @Autowired 起作用必须事先在 Spring 容器中声明 AutowiredAnnota...原创 2010-03-04 04:18:29 · 111 阅读 · 0 评论 -
JAX-RS cxf web服务 rest简单增删改查 集成spring webService
没时间什么也不多说了。所有的话都在代码里。 一、第一步,首先下载cxf 开发文档 官方地址:http://cxf.apache.org/download.html 去下载一个最新了。 二、本地解压,里面有一个lib。建一个web项目把 jar 拷进去,就开始开工了。 三、打开web.xml 加入服务启动置配 <context-pa...2011-09-14 14:35:20 · 219 阅读 · 0 评论 -
aop svn
aop http://student.youkuaiyun.com/space.php?uid=22816&do=thread&id=18866 svn http://blog.youkuaiyun.com/harbor1981/archive/2006/10/04/1320065.aspx原创 2010-11-30 08:31:57 · 91 阅读 · 0 评论 -
spring mvc rest 小例子
http://localhost:8080/mainrest/user/list/1234.json http://localhost:8080/mainrest/user/list/1234.xml WEB-INF/dispatcher-servlet.xml<?xml version="1.0" encoding="UTF-8"?><beans ...2012-05-24 15:35:41 · 112 阅读 · 0 评论 -
在Spring应用中使用Hibernate
<1>Spring in Hibernate示例<1 在Spring配置文件 <bean id="dataSource" class="org.springframework.jdbc.datasource.DriverManagerDataSource"> <property name="d...原创 2009-08-04 11:56:36 · 80 阅读 · 0 评论 -
基于Spring的数据访问
(1)在Spring应用中使用JDBCSpring对JDBC进行了良好的封装,通过提供相应的模板和辅助类,在相当程度上降低了JDBC操作的复杂性。并且得益于Spring良好的隔离设计,JDBC封装类库可以脱离Spring Context独立使用,也就是说,即使系统并没有采用Spring作为结构性框架,我们也可以单独使用Spring的JDBC部分来改善我们的代码。<1>回顾JDB...原创 2009-08-03 22:52:14 · 146 阅读 · 0 评论 -
spring_hibernate_struts2_一个小实例
没有jar包。标准的。2009-07-26 17:09:45 · 76 阅读 · 0 评论 -
spring + struts + hibernate 中的spring配置
1 加入spring jar包。 加入要用到的包就行了。2创建一个配置文件。名为applicationContext.xml ,放到“WebRoot/WEB-INF”目录下 便于管理。3向Struts-config.xml 中添加Spring插件。如下代码: <plug-in className="org.springframework.web.struts.Co...2009-08-03 10:47:41 · 74 阅读 · 0 评论 -
spring ioc控制反转
IOC,全称(Inverse Of Control),中文意思为:控制反转,Spring框架的核心基于控制反转原理。什么是控制反转?控制反转是一种将组件依赖关系的创建和管理置于程序外部的技术。l 由容器控制程序之间的关系,而不是由代码直接控制l 由于控制权由代码转向了容器,所以称为反转 对象与对象之间的关系可以简单的理解为对象之间的依赖关系:...2009-08-03 16:21:23 · 79 阅读 · 0 评论 -
spring 注入参数(Injection Parameters)
(1)简单的值注入将简单的值注入到beans里面是很简单的。如果需要,只需要简单地在配置标记中指定值,将其封装在一个<value>标记中,默认情况,<value>标记不仅能读取String值,而且也可以将这些值转换到任何原生数据类型或者原生封装类。示例:Bean:public class InjectSimple{private String na...2009-08-03 16:25:59 · 191 阅读 · 0 评论 -
spring 中自动装配你的Bean
如果你不喜欢自己将你的程序装配起来,你可以尝试让Spring自动装配。默认情况,自动装配是被关闭的。开启它,需要指定你想要使用哪种自动装配方法,给你想要自动装配的bean配置指定autowire属性。 Spring支持四种自动装配模式:通过命名、通过类型、构造器或自动检测。 通过命名自动装配:Spring尝试将每个属性连接到一个同名的bean上。因此,如果目标bean拥有一个叫做f...2009-08-03 16:27:06 · 74 阅读 · 0 评论 -
spring 中 Bean继承
某些情况下,你也许需要定义多个实现了共用接口的相同类型的bean。这时,如果你希望这些bean共享一些配置但又有一些不同的设置,这会是个问题。保持共享配置同步的过程经常出错,在大项目中这样做还非常耗时。为了解决这个问题,Spring允许你定义一个<bean>从Bean工厂的其他bean处继承属性设置。如果需要,你可以重写需要的子bean中的任何一个属性的值,这使你可以进行完全的控制,父...2009-08-03 16:29:58 · 72 阅读 · 0 评论 -
Spring bean的封装机制
Spring 从核心而言,是一个DI 容器,其设计哲学是提供一种无侵入式的高扩展性框架。即无需代码中涉及Spring专有类,即可将其纳入Spring容器进行管理。作为对比,EJB则是一种高度侵入性的框架规范,它制定了众多的接口和编码规范,要求实现者必须遵从。侵入性的后果就是,一旦系统基于侵入性框架设计开发,那么之后任何脱离这个框架的企图都将付出极大的代价。为了避免这种情况,实现无侵入性的目...2009-08-03 16:31:48 · 145 阅读 · 0 评论 -
Spring的体系结构
Spring 框架是一个分层架构,由 7个定义良好的模块组成。Spring 模块构建在核心容器之上,核心容器定义了创建、配置和管理 bean 的方式Spring框架图: <1>核心容器核心容器提供 Spring 框架的基本功能。核心容器的主要组件是 BeanFactory,它是工厂模式的实现。BeanFactory 使用控制反转(IOC)模式将应用程序的...原创 2009-08-03 16:42:12 · 116 阅读 · 0 评论 -
Spring中常用三种通知
(1)前置通知接口:org.springframework.aop.MethodBeforeAdvice使用前置通知可以在联结点执行前进行自定义的操作。不过,Spring里只有一种联结点,即方法调用,所以前置通知事实上就是让你能在方法调用前进行一些操作。前置通知可以访问调用的目标方法,也可以对该方法的参数进行操作,不过它不能影响方法调用本身。 示例: IHello接口...原创 2009-08-03 17:14:49 · 139 阅读 · 0 评论 -
Java 数据验证
在web开发当前就会遇到一些数据有效性验证的相关代码编写。一般的写法如: public class User { public String username; public String password; public Integer age;} public addUser(User user) { St...2017-05-12 10:27:50 · 236 阅读 · 0 评论